581447
0000000000000000002088d08a947809ff5758f043b443b799b9961b8225ea12
Time
06-20-2019 00:19:18 (Local)
Sponsored
Transaction Fees
0.19923785
BTC
Confirmations
315976
Total Amounts
5773871.28932828 USDT
Transaction Counts
603
Previous Block:
Merkle Root:
2a97fb0a4def810de571c391e220dddfb190ee523845daffcca90665136811ba